The Importance Of Implementing An Inventory Management System

In any business, managing inventory is a crucial aspect of ensuring smooth operations and maximizing profitability An efficient and effective inventory management system is essential for keeping track of stock levels, monitoring sales trends, and optimizing order fulfillment processes With the advancement of technology, businesses now have access to sophisticated inventory management systems that can streamline operations and improve overall productivity.

One of the key benefits of implementing an inventory management system is the ability to accurately track inventory levels in real-time This is particularly important for businesses that carry a large number of products or operate across multiple locations With an inventory management system, businesses can easily monitor stock levels, track sales trends, and receive alerts when inventory levels are running low This ensures that businesses can restock inventory in a timely manner, reducing the risk of stockouts and lost sales.

Another advantage of using an inventory management system is the ability to improve order fulfillment processes By automating the order fulfillment process, businesses can reduce manual errors, streamline order processing, and minimize the risk of stock discrepancies This not only improves customer satisfaction but also helps businesses save time and money by reducing the need for manual intervention.

Furthermore, an inventory management system can help businesses optimize their supply chain by providing valuable insights into inventory levels, sales trends, and customer demand By analyzing this data, businesses can make informed decisions about when to reorder stock, which products to prioritize, and how to allocate resources more effectively This can help businesses improve overall efficiency, reduce costs, and increase profitability.

By accurately tracking inventory levels and sales trends, businesses can identify slow-moving products, obsolete stock, and overstock situations This allows businesses to make informed decisions about how to liquidate excess inventory, negotiate better terms with suppliers, and optimize inventory levels to reduce carrying costs.

Moreover, an inventory management system can help businesses improve accuracy and reduce the risk of theft or fraud By implementing barcode scanning, RFID technology, and other advanced tracking methods, businesses can reduce the risk of manual errors, track inventory movements more accurately, and prevent unauthorized access to sensitive inventory data This can help businesses improve security, protect valuable assets, and maintain compliance with regulatory requirements.
